Comments about Pampers Cruisers Extra Large Case - Sizes 3, 4, 5, 6, 7:

The new design of these diapers is TERRIBLE! I have been buying Pampers for my kids since they were born, and have always loved the Cruisers. When I went to reorder from Diapers.com, I noticed reviews about the new design. I was hesitant to purchase, but I went ahead and as soon as I pulled the first diaper out of the package, I regretted my purchase. The mesh is gone, as is half the liner up the back! I'm paying the same amount of $ for half the quality! I put the new diaper on my son at bedtime, and when he woke up in the morning, he had leaked all over the front of his pajamas. I should have listened to all of the reviewers, and saved my money. I am very disappointed in Pampers. Thankfully, my son will be starting potty training soon and will switch to pull-ups, but in the meantime, I'm switching to Huggies Supreme. Incidentally, I did call Pampers to complain, and got the standard script...they made the changes in response to moms saying that the Cruisers were "bulky" around the front...seriously?? If that's the case, then why remove half the pad UP THE BACK?? I was also informed that I could purchase "Cruisers Premium"...which has 10% more aborbency...and of course costs more for less diapers...and is only available at one retailer. So basically, if you want the quality of the old "Cruisers", you have pay more for less product and buy "Cruisers Premium"...which is a bit of an oxymoron, b/c the old "Cruisers" WAS SUPPOSED to be Pampers' PREMIUM diaper! The one nice thing in all of this is that the Pampers Rep I spoke with was very professional, and Pampers is sending me a FULL refund for the package of 140 diapers that I purchased. NOTE TO PAMPERS..."we get it, you needed to cut costs in this economy...no one is being fooled, please don't disguise it as something good!"

Comments about Pampers Cruisers Extra Large Case - Sizes 3, 4, 5, 6, 7:

Pampers recently changed the design of their Cruisers line and cheapened it significantly. They took away the mesh lining and shortened the internal absorbant pad. The end result has been leaky diapers! We've changed to Huggies which seem to work better. I would switch back to Pampers, but only if they go back to the mesh pad and longer liner. Terrible product decision- I would guess that the new design is cheaper to make and therefore, increase their profit margins.
